Kamaldeen Sulemana of FC Nordsjaelland in Danish Superliga has been identified as a potential transfer target for Bundesliga giants, Bayer Leverkusen, SportsworldGhana can exclusively reveal.
The German giants have been monitoring the progress of the Ghana International who has been a revelation at the Red and Yellows club this season in Denmark.

SportsworldGhana can confirm that the German team have sent scouts to monitor the young lad and have received positive feedback concerning the performance of the youngster.
Leverkusen are impressed with the 19-year-old’s progression at the ‘Right to Dream’ Club and are set to make a summer move for the High-flying Ghanaian kid.
Sulemana has been a pivot for the Wild Tigers this season and has been constantly playing in the Denmark top-flight with an eye-catching performance week-in-week-out.
After his stellar display and consistent performances, Dutch Eredivisie biggest club AFC Ajax Amsterdam and Olympic Lyon of France have made the young man their prime target but now faces competition from other clubs including Leverkusen.

On Friday April 30, Suleman was named Young-Player-Of-The-Month and Player-Of-The-Month in the Danish top-flight after banging in four goals and three assists and making the team of the week three times.
Ajax are favourite to sign the youngster after the club snapped Kudus Mohammed from the Wild Tigers but Leverkusen are set to beat the Dutch giants to the signature of the young man.

The 19-year-old Ghanaian has scored nine goals and provided five assists in the league this season for Nordsjaelland in Denmark and could be on a big money move in the upcoming summer transfer window.
